2. How “Highly Compressed” Works

Compression falls into two categories:

| Type | Method | Effect on Game | Example | |------|--------|----------------|---------| | Lossless | Algorithms (LZMA, Zstandard) remove redundant data | No quality loss, slower decompression | Standard repacks | | Lossy | Downsample audio, reduce video bitrate, remove FMVs | Noticeable lower audio quality, blocky cutscenes | “Super compressed” (under 1 GB) | god of war 2 highly compressed pc better

Lossless compression simply requires CPU power to decompress during installation. Lossy compression permanently degrades assets—music may sound tinny, pre-rendered cutscenes (plentiful in God of War 2) become pixelated.

6. Comparison Table: Repack vs. Legal Emulation

| Feature | Highly Compressed Repack | Legal ISO + Official PCSX2 | |---------|------------------------|-----------------------------| | File size | 0.5–2 GB | 4.5 GB (ISO) + 30 MB (emulator) | | Install time | 20–60 min (decompression) | 0 min (mount or open ISO) | | Malware risk | High (unknown repacker) | None | | Cutscene quality | Often degraded (lossy) | Original, can be upscaled | | Performance | Variable (old emulator) | Excellent (new optimizations) | | Widescreen/60 FPS | Rarely included | Easily patched | | Legal | Copyright violation | Legal (with owned disc) |

Here is a guide to optimizing the experience on PC, especially for lower-end machines. 1. The Setup (Emulator & Game) Use the latest PCSX2 Nightly Build

. These versions include better optimizations for lower-end hardware, such as Vulkan renderer support. Compressed ISO:

Look for a "God of War 2 PS2 Rip" or "Highly Compressed" file. These usually remove language files to save space. You will need a PS2 BIOS file to run the emulator. 2. Best Settings for "Better" (Low-End) Performance

If the game runs in slow motion (a common issue with GoW2), try these settings in PCSX2: for better performance, or if Vulkan causes graphical bugs. Internal Resolution: Native (PS2)

for best performance. Increase to 2x or 3x only if your PC can handle it. Speedhacks: (Multi-Threaded VU1) - This provides a huge boost to FPS. EE Cyclerate to 1 or 2 (underclocking) to help slower CPUs. VU Cycle Stealing to 1 or 2. Fix Slow Motion: If the game is still too slow, ensure Frame Skipping

is enabled in the Speedhacks menu to keep the game running at full speed. 3. Enhancements for a Better Experience If your PC is decent and you want "Better" visuals: HD Textures:
